Rheumatologic and autoimmune diseases are disorders in which the immune system targets the body's own tissues erroneously, causing chronic inflammation and tissue damage. Usually affecting the joints, muscles, skin, and internal organs, these diseases also impact Among the conditions are rheumatoid arthritis, lupus, ankylosing spondylitis, Sjögren's syndrome, and systemic sclerosis.
The body in autoimmune diseases cannot tell healthy cells from dangerous intruders. This immunological malfunction leads to inflammation, discomfort, oedema, and functional disability. Common symptoms are joint stiffness, tiredness, rashes, fever, and muscular weakness—all of which could flare up and go away with time. A few diseases, including lupus, can also compromise the kidneys, heart, or lungs.
Diagnosis consists of clinical assessment, blood tests for certain autoantibodies, imaging, and occasionally biopsy. Early diagnosis and treatment can significantly increase quality of life and stop permanent harm even if these diseases are sometimes chronic and incurable.
Usually including immunosuppressants, corticosteroids, NSAIDs, and biologics aiming at particular immune system components, treatment also involves Crucial also are changes in lifestyle, including frequent exercise, stress control, and a balanced diet.
Maintaining everyday functioning and long-term disease treatment depends on constant medical care, patient education, and professional support, including rheumatologists.
